Compaq Laptops Restart Instead of Powering Down

SYMPTOMS

Some Compaq computers do not power down after shutdown after you set the registry value
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Microsoft\WindowsNT\CurrentVersion\winlogon\

PowerdownAfterShutdown:REG_SZ:1
when you are using the Microsoft HAL. This value enables a Shut Down And Power Off option on the Shut Down menu, but if you use this option, the computer restarts instead of shutting down.

Back to the top

CAUSE

This feature does not work correctly with the HAL included with Windows NT 4.0.

Back to the top

RESOLUTION

To use this feature, you must obtain the HAL that supports this feature from the computer's manufacturer.

It comes as part of the power management Softpaq, which you can download from Compaq's Web site (http://www.compaq.com (http://www.compaq.com)).
